Introduction

If you're an avid off-road biker, investing in high-quality trailguide tires is essential for your adventures. These tires are engineered to tackle rough terrains, ensuring that you have the grip and stability you need when navigating through dirt paths, rocky trails, and muddy tracks. Trailguide tires feature aggressive tread patterns that enhance traction, allowing you to confidently maneuver through various obstacles.

When choosing trailguide tires, consider factors such as tire width, tread design, and durability. Wider tires offer better stability, while a well-designed tread can significantly improve your bike's performance in slippery conditions.

Additionally, many trailguide tires are made from robust materials that resist punctures and wear, making them a reliable choice for long-distance rides. Whether you’re a seasoned biker or just starting, trailguide tires can elevate your biking experience, providing the confidence to explore new trails.

Don't forget to check for compatibility with your bike model and ensure proper installation for optimal performance. With the right trailguide tires, you’ll be ready to take on any challenge the trail throws your way!

FAQs

What are trailguide tires?

Trailguide tires are specialized tires designed for off-road biking, offering enhanced traction and durability on rugged terrains.

How do I choose the right trailguide tires for my bike?

Consider factors such as tire width, tread design, and compatibility with your bike model when selecting trailguide tires.

Can trailguide tires be used on paved roads?

While trailguide tires are primarily designed for off-road use, they can be used on paved roads, but may not provide the best performance.

How often should I replace my trailguide tires?

Replace your trailguide tires when you notice significant wear, reduced traction, or if they become damaged.

Are trailguide tires suitable for beginners?

Yes, trailguide tires can be suitable for beginners, providing added stability and control on various terrains.
